Real-World Testing: Putting S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 HELLFIRE RET Riflescopes, Second Focal Plane to the Test

First Use Experience

I first tested the S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 at my local shooting range, mounting it on an AR-15 platform chambered in 5.56 NATO. The range offered distances from 25 yards to 300 yards, allowing me to thoroughly evaluate the optic’s performance across its magnification range. The weather was slightly overcast, providing a decent test of the glass clarity in less-than-ideal lighting conditions.

The 1x performance was impressive. It allowed for rapid target acquisition at close ranges, behaving almost like a red dot sight. Transitioning to 6x magnification was smooth and easy, providing a clear and detailed view of targets at 300 yards.

My initial issue was with the illumination knob. Unlike other SIG SAUER optics I have used with the Hellfire reticle, this one does not have an “off” position between each intensity setting. This means you have to cycle through all the brightness levels to turn the illumination off, which is less than ideal.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several range trips spanning several weeks, the S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 has proven to be a reliable optic. It has held zero consistently, even after repeated adjustments and changes in magnification. There are no visible signs of wear and tear beyond minor cosmetic scuffs, demonstrating a solid build quality.

Cleaning the lenses is straightforward, and the flip-back scope caps provide adequate protection when not in use. Compared to a previous optic I used in this price range, the S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 provides noticeably better glass clarity and a more forgiving eye box. It definitely outperforms the other budget optic in this regard.

However, my opinion about the reticle illumination knob has not changed. Having to cycle through all the brightness levels to turn the illumination off continues to be a minor annoyance.

Breaking Down the Features of S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 HELLFIRE RET Riflescopes, Second Focal Plane

Specifications

The S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 HELLFIRE RET Riflescopes, Second Focal Plane boasts the following key specifications:

  • Objective Lens Diameter: 24 mm. This provides a good balance between light gathering and a compact profile.
  • Magnification: 1 – 6 x. This provides versatility for close quarters to mid-range engagements.
  • Reticle: FL-6 Hellfire Illuminated Reticle. This offers a clear and intuitive aiming point with adjustable brightness.
  • Tube Diameter: 30 mm. This larger tube diameter allows for a wider range of adjustment.
  • Field of View, Linear: 19.6 – 124.8 ft at 100 yds. This wide field of view enhances situational awareness, particularly at lower magnifications.
  • Eye Relief: 3.74 – 3.93 in. This provides a comfortable and safe shooting experience.
  • Weight: 18.5 oz. This is a reasonable weight for a 1-6x optic.
  • Illumination Type: LED. This provides a bright and efficient illumination source.
  • Battery Type: CR2032. This is a common and readily available battery type.
  • Adjustment Range: 44 MOA. This allows for precise adjustments to compensate for bullet drop and windage.
  • W/E Travel at 100 Yds: 100 MOA. This provides ample adjustment range for various shooting scenarios.

These specifications combine to create a versatile and capable optic suitable for a wide range of applications. The magnification range, illuminated reticle, and generous field of view make it particularly well-suited for tactical and hunting scenarios.

Performance & Functionality

The S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 performs admirably for an optic in its price range. The glass clarity is above average, providing a clear and bright image even in less-than-ideal lighting conditions. The Hellfire reticle is easy to see and use, offering a precise aiming point.

However, the absence of an “off” position between illumination settings on the brightness knob is a definite weakness. This requires the user to cycle through all the brightness levels to turn the illumination off, which can be time-consuming and inconvenient, especially in tactical situations. The optic otherwise meets expectations for functionality.

Design & Ergonomics

The S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 features a robust and functional design. The construction is solid, and the controls are easy to access and manipulate. The integrated throw lever on the magnification ring is a nice touch, allowing for quick and easy magnification adjustments.

The optic’s weight is reasonable, and it balances well on an AR-15 platform. The only minor ergonomic complaint is the slightly stiff magnification ring, though it loosens up with use.

Durability & Maintenance

The S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 appears to be a durable optic. The aluminum housing is well-machined and the lenses are scratch-resistant. Cleaning is straightforward, requiring only a lens cloth and gentle cleaning solution.

Given SIG SAUER’s reputation for quality, I expect this optic to last for many years with proper care. The dependable waterproof, shockproof, and fog-proof performance inspire confidence.

Accessories and Customization Options

The SIG TANGO MSR 1-6X24 ships with lay-flat flip-back scope caps, which are a practical and convenient addition. This version is sold without a mount, giving the user the freedom to choose a mount that best suits their needs and rifle platform. It is compatible with any standard 30mm scope mount.

There are no other factory accessories or customization options available for this optic. However, the standard 30mm tube diameter allows for compatibility with a wide range of aftermarket mounts and accessories.
